The Opportunity:

As an experienced engineer, you know that machine learning is critical to understanding and processing massive datasets. Your ability to conduct statistical analyses on workflow processes using ML techniques makes you an integral part of delivering a customer-focused solution. We need your technical knowledge and desire to problem-solve to support research and development for a key national defense client. As an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ML) Engineer on our intelligence team, you'll train, test, deploy, and maintain models that learn from data.

In this role, you'll own and define the direction of mission-critical solutions by applying best-fit ML algorithms and technologies. You'll be part of a large community of ML engineers across the company and collaborate with software developers and engineers as well as end users to deliver world‑class solutions to develop and drive solutions to remote sensing issues for operations clients. You will be testing and driving AI/ML concepts and solutions for a data-intensive system.

As data feeds continue to be brought online, the relatively fixed number of operators needs your help driving solutions. Your advanced skills and extensive technical expertise will guide clients as they navigate the landscape of ML algorithms, tools, and frameworks.

What You'll Work On:
  • Design, build, and deploy NLP models for text classification, information extraction, and automated sorting.

  • Develop and maintain machine learning pipelines from experimentation through production deployment.

  • Create data visualizations, plots, and dashboards to communicate model outputs and analytical findings.

  • Collaborate with stakeholders to translate mission requirements into technical solutions and deliver client-focused products.

  • Implement MLOps best practices, including experiment tracking, model versioning, and performance monitoring.

  • Evaluate model performance, conduct A/B testing, and optimize algorithms for accuracy and scalability.

  • Document technical approaches and communicate results to both technical and mission-focused audiences.

You Have:
  • 3+ years of experience in delivering AI and ML-based solutions for object identification and classification.

  • 3+ years of experience with Python coding and libraries, including scikit-learn, spaCy, Hugging Face, Tensor Flow, and PyTorch.

  • Experience with Natural Language Processing for text classification, sorting algorithms, and NLP Model Development.

  • Experience with remote sensing image processing, data exploitation, and algorithm development.

  • Experience with software configuration management using Git.

  • Ability to execute machine learning models in a Linux environment.

  • TS/SCI clearance.

  • Bachelor's degree.

Nice If You Have:
  • Experience with container technology, including Docker or Podman.

  • Experience with Databricks for ML workflows, including experiment tracking, model deployment, and Spark integration.

  • Knowledge of passive EO or IR systems.

  • Ability to work with limited guidance and clear direction.

  • Possession of excellent verbal and written communication skills, including with peers and clients.

  • Bachelor's degree in Data Science or an Engineering field, such as AI and ML Engineering, preferred;
    Master's degree in Data Science or an Engineering field, such as AI and ML Engineering a plus.
